orce-field analysis suggests that _____. a. the only effective way to ensure change is to force it b. when restraining forces ar
VashaNatasha [74]

Answer:

b. when restraining forces are removed, driving forces will produce change

Explanation:

Force field analysis is a theory of Kurt Lewin in his contribution to change management.

This model suggests how change agents may diagnose the forces that drive and restrain proposed organizational change. It draws from this that change agents can only cause change to happen if they eliminate forces restraining order resisting this change.

Lewin list four forces in his research: change forces, driving forces, restraining forces and resisting forces, suggesting that in order for a change to happen the driving forces have to be more than the restraining forces and an equilibrium means no change.
